Pete Jackson has produced a nice little topo of a circuit around Low Roof. It includes problems from the guide and some previously undocumented ones.
A guide added to the Nidderdale section describing the bouldering that is in the YG guide and a lot of new problems from Font 7c+ to Font 4 including some that are very very good. Ash Head Bouldering Prints A5.
There’s a newly developed boulder at the north end of the Brimham Rocks estate – Thanks to Alex Thompson for the effort and the topo. Looks good. Also, recent visits to the fine Lund Stones have added several good problems and repeats of the older ones. Scott Walker pulling hard on Delph Quest 6b. Windgate Nick – new problems. Some newly unearthed problems at Windgate Nick. A collection of traverses and link-ups of increasing difficulty and a couple of up problems in a hidden delph. There are also a few problems near the classic Fintastic 6a.
A new and good little venue between Round Hill and Slipstones developed by Steven Phelps. Set in a fine location and not too far from the road! Spruce Gill Boulders
